The President of Tulane University, where Peter Gold attends medical school, has made a statement about the arrest of Gold’s attacker. Gold had tried stopping an attack on a woman last week and got shot by her attacker.
Michael Fitts wrote of his “gratitude and relief that the suspect in Friday’s shooting of Tulane medical student Peter Gold has been arrested.” The New Orleans Police Department arrested 21-year-old Euric Cain at the home of his girlfriend, and then arrested the girlfriend on charges of accessory after the fact for hiding Cain.
Cain shot Gold Friday morning around 4:00 am., at the 1000 block of Saint Mary Street when Gold tried intervening as Cain attempted to abduct a woman.
Cain is being charged with Attempted First Degree Murder, Armed Robbery, Attempted Armed Robbery and Second Degree Kidnapping.
Cain is being held without bail.
“We are indebted to the New Orleans Police Department and the U.S. Marshal Service for apprehending the suspect in this case,” said Fitts. “We continue to keep Peter and the Gold family utmost in our thoughts and ask everyone to do the same. We also ask that everyone continue to respect the Gold family’s need for privacy.
Gold’s condition is currently “guarded” but he “continues to improve.”
